The article examines international and national legal mechanisms for protecting children from all forms of violence within the framework of a democratic state governed by the rule of law. Special attention is paid to the UN Convention on the Rights of the Child, particularly Article 19, which establishes states’ obligations to prevent, detect, and respond to violence against children. The role of positive state obligations and the principle of the best interests of the child is analyzed. The study also reviews the updated Constitution of the Republic of Uzbekistan, the Law “On Guarantees of the Rights of the Child”, and the 2024 Law “On the Protection of Children from All Forms of Violence”. Emphasis is placed on the comprehensive and intersectoral nature of the child protection system, combining legal, social, and preventive measures. The article concludes that effective protection of children’s rights requires not only normative regulation but also functioning enforcement mechanisms and systematic state control.
